Westerstede (Low German: Westerstäe) is a town (22,399 inhabitants end 2016), capital of the Ammerland district, in Lower Saxony, Germany. It is known for hosting the Rhodo Festival, the biggest exhibition of rhododendrons in Europe. The festival is hosted every four years.
